KC Chiefs head coach Andy Reid acknowledging Tony Moeaki would be out until training camp was the lead story coming out of the final day of OTAs this week but there were two other notable story lines involving Dexter McCluster and Tyson Jackson.
The Kansas City Chiefs have yet to face any injury problems in the 2013 offseason ... with the exception of Tony Moeaki. The KC Chiefs fourth-year tight end hasn't participated this offseason and likely won't be ready until training camp.
